21xrx.com
2024-12-22 22:42:00 Sunday
登录
文章检索 我的文章 写文章
C++实现小写字母转换为大写字母的代码
2023-07-09 08:14:46 深夜i     --     --
C++ 小写字母 大写字母 转换 代码

C++ 是一种强大的编程语言,可以实现各种各样的功能。其中之一就是小写字母转换为大写字母。下面给出一份代码示例。


#include <iostream>

using namespace std;

int main()

{

  char ch;

  cout << "请输入一个小写字母:";

  cin >> ch;

  if(ch >= 'a' && ch <= 'z') // 判断 ch 是否为小写字母

  

    ch -= 32; // 将 ch 转换为大写字母

    cout << "转换后的大写字母为:" << ch << endl;

  

  else

  

    cout << "输入的不是小写字母!" << endl;

  

  return 0;

}

以上代码的实现思路非常简单:首先让用户输入一个小写字母;接着通过 if 语句判断该字符是否为小写字母;如果是,则通过将其 ascii 码值减去32来实现由小写字母转为大写字母;最后输出结果。

这段代码的价值在于它让我们了解到 C++ 中 char 类型变量中存储的是字符的 ascii 码。利用这个知识点,我们可以轻松实现各种字符的转换和处理,从而实现更为复杂的功能。

总的来说,C++ 是一款非常强大的编程语言,具有广泛的用途。通过学习 char 类型的 ascii 码值知识点,我们可以在 C++ 中实现各种字符的转换和处理,为我们日常生活和工作中的编程问题提供了更强大的解决方案。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复